Rebecca Bossenbroek

Director of Finance

Email: finance@mittensynod.org

Rebecca has served in this role since May 2018, working part-time remotely during non-traditional
hours. She reports to the Bishop and partners with the Vice President and Treasurer to develop policy,
create budgets, and monitor financial performance.

Her work with the Synod began in 2005 as Executive Assistant for Administration and included the role
of Equipping Leaders for Mission & Ministry Administrator from 2013-2022. She holds a Bachelor of
Business Administration from Davenport University and is a Certified Human Resources Specialist.

She served in several positions with St. Stephen Lutheran Church in Lansing: Director of Worship,
Treasurer, President, Secretary, and Finance Team Leader. Currently, Rebecca serves as an
Ordained Ruling Elder with First Presbyterian Church in Holt, where she is part of the Worship
Committee, sings in the choir, and coordinates children’s involvement in worship, emphasizing music,
movement, and meaning.

Rebecca is a dedicated member of Sistrum (aka Lansing Women’s Chorus), a 60-voice group known
for their commitment to social justice in the greater-Lansing community. A life-long learner, she invests
her time and energy in courses offered by Union Presbyterian Seminary’s Womanist Leadership
Institute.
